The kicking of snow over a helpless victim covering them head to toe. Beerows meaning comes from buried, burrowed etc Dundee dialect.
by Dundee Dialect February 11, 2021
Get the Beerow mug.
Get the Beerow mug.We'll email you a link to sign in instantly.